31 /*
32  * delayed back reference update tracking.  For subvolume trees
33  * we queue up extent allocations and backref maintenance for
34  * delayed processing.   This avoids deep call chains where we
35  * add extents in the middle of btrfs_search_slot, and it allows
36  * us to buffer up frequently modified backrefs in an rb tree instead
37  * of hammering updates on the extent allocation tree.
38  */
